I tested it with viper soft 1.0 and mizuno Q5 2.0. Chops are amazing. It is not too fast so you can chop well but with an offensive rubber on forhand you can attack properly. Counterattack away from the table is perfect but what I love is a high speed and accurate backhand counterattack close to the table.
Also i bought a gewo hype xt 50 1.9. It is half price less than mizuno and for me it is better for chopping and counterattacking, block is as good as mizuno.
